WebPurpose The Division of Child Development and Early Education assesses an annual license fee to active child care providers in accordance with N.C.G.S. 110-90(1a). Annual License Fee Invoice Amounts Family Child Care Homes $52.00 Centers (capacity of 0-12) $52.00 Centers (capacity of 13-50) $187.00 Centers (capacity of 51-100) ... The Division of Social Services licenses child-placing agencies for foster care, child-placing agencies for adoption, residential child-care facilities, residential maternity homes and foster homes. Our consultants are committed to protecting children who, for a variety of reasons, find themselves living apart from their families. Caring for Mi Future is a $100 million strategy to open 1,000 new child care programs by the end of 2024. This is one piece of a historic $1.4 billion investment to expand access to quality, affordable child care for families.
